SIGONO’s Narrative Adventure ‘OPUS: Rocket of Whispers’ Arrives on September 14th

Developer SIGONO, formerly known as Team Signal and creators of the fantastic 2015 narrative adventure OPUS: The Day We Found Earth (Free), are back with a follow-up title called OPUS: Rocket of Whispers. Like The Day We Found Earth, Rocket of Whispers is built around a pretty unique premise. You’ll follow the stories of John, the son of a rocket engineer, and Fei, a witch who has been in cryo-sleep for the past twenty years, as they scavenge a post-apocalyptic world in search of enough materials to build a rocket which they’ll use to launch a space burial for the departed souls of their desolate planet. From SIGONO’s own description, “As they gather materials for the rocket, the story behind the demise of their world will slowly unfold through the ruins and artifacts they find."

The scavenging portions of OPUS: Rocket of Whispers plays out from a top-down view as you explore the post-apocalyptic landscape, and much like the previous game The Day We Found Earth, the fantastic soundtrack creates an eerie mood and there’s a heavy focus on the relationship of the two main characters.
